a new approach for the ui
This commit is contained in:
parent
cc85486414
commit
f0cfc19f8c
34 changed files with 2246 additions and 146 deletions
21
app/ui/header.js
Normal file
21
app/ui/header.js
Normal file
|
@ -0,0 +1,21 @@
|
|||
const html = require('choo/html');
|
||||
const account = require('./account');
|
||||
|
||||
module.exports = function(state, emit) {
|
||||
const header = html`
|
||||
<header class="flex-none flex flex-row items-center bg-white w-full px-4 h-12 shadow-md justify-between">
|
||||
<a
|
||||
class="header-logo"
|
||||
href="/">
|
||||
<h1 class="text-black font-normal">Firefox <b>Send</b></h1>
|
||||
</a>
|
||||
${account(state, emit)}
|
||||
</header>`;
|
||||
// HACK
|
||||
// We only want to render this once because we
|
||||
// toggle the targets of the links with utils/openLinksInNewTab
|
||||
// header.isSameNode = function(target) {
|
||||
// return target && target.nodeName && target.nodeName === 'HEADER';
|
||||
// };
|
||||
return header;
|
||||
};
|
Loading…
Add table
Add a link
Reference in a new issue